Is the Anime Origins unit called Akeno or Aneko?

The release footage and current guide coverage use Akeno. Aneko appears to be a common search spelling rather than a separate Anime Origins unit. This page covers Akeno so both searches reach the same answer.

What does Akeno do?

Akeno is presented as a hill unit with lightning element and a stun status effect. That combination gives her two useful jobs: hitting flying targets that ground-only units may miss and interrupting enemies so the rest of the squad gets more attack time.

Akeno element matchups

The element panel shown in the August 14 release guide lists:

MatchupDisplayed damage
Water-attuned enemies150%
Earth enemies65%

That means Akeno can look much stronger on a water-heavy map and much weaker into earth. Do not judge her from a single run without checking the enemy element.

Where should I place Akeno?

Use a hill position that:

  • sees a long section of the flying path;
  • lets multiple waves remain in range;
  • applies stun before enemies reach the final turn;
  • does not overlap completely with another hill-only unit.

Long sightlines generally produce more total attacks than a hill at the very end of the route. If the map splits, place her where both branches enter range or reserve another air answer for the uncovered lane.

Which traits fit Akeno?

Choose based on the role you need:

  • Cooldown: more attack cycles can mean more stun opportunities.
  • Range: useful when one hill must cover a long or split route.
  • Damage: stronger when the stage already has enough control.
  • Balanced stats: Ace is a flexible launch roll when you do not want to chase a narrow specialist.

Do not spend unlimited Trait Rerolls just because Akeno is useful. Set a budget and keep a role-fitting mid-tier roll if it already solves the stage.

Is Akeno a must-pull?

She is a high-value role target for a roster lacking air coverage or control, but “must-pull” depends on your current units, banner, and elements. If you already own reliable hybrid coverage and stun, a boss carry or income unit may improve the account more.
